Esko Riekki
Summary
Esko Riekki is a human[1]. Born in Oulu[2], he… he was born on April 29, 1891[3]. He passed away in Helsinki[4]. He died on October 30, 1973[5]. He worked as a police officer[6] and recruiter[7].
